Will Forte and Lana Condor celebrate the long‑awaited release of family‑friendly “Coyote vs. Acme”

LOS ANGELES — After a protracted and uncertain journey, the family‑oriented adventure Coyote vs. Acme is poised to reach theaters thanks to a new distribution deal. The film, which blends live action with classic Looney Tunes animation, was originally slated for a 2023 release before Warner Bros. shelved the project, leaving it without a theatrical or streaming home.

New distributor gives the movie a second chance

Ketchup Entertainment stepped in, acquiring the rights and charting a clear path to release. With the backing of a dedicated distributor, the movie can finally fulfill the vision of its creators and the hundreds of crew members who worked on it.

Stars reflect on perseverance and hope

Will Forte, who plays the determined Wile E. Coyote, described the experience as a lesson in perseverance. “We worked really hard on it—hundreds of people gave their all,” Forte said. “The movie’s finished, it’s testing well, and then they were ready to toss it away. It taught me that change can happen, so don’t give up hope. It’s like Wile E. in the movie—he never gives up.”

Lana Condor, who portrays the film’s human lead, emphasized the project’s family‑friendly appeal. “Everyone can go,” she noted. “We’ve lost a lot of big blockbuster family movies that the whole family can enjoy. It’s an honor to be part of something that brings families together.”

What the film offers

Coyote vs. Acme brings together beloved Looney Tunes characters—including Wile E. Coyote, the Road Runner, Bugs Bunny, Porky Pig, and Daffy Duck—in a story where the coyote takes on the infamous Acme Corporation, the source of his famously faulty gadgets. The hybrid format aims to blend the charm of classic animation with modern live‑action storytelling, delivering a nostalgic yet fresh experience for both longtime fans and new viewers.

Industry insiders say the film’s testing results have been positive, suggesting that audiences will respond well to its humor, heart, and visual style. With a release date now secured, the movie is expected to roll out to theaters nationwide later this year.
